Suggest a better descriptionCombine first 4 ingredients in a heavy non-reactive saucepan. Stir in milk and egg yolks. Bring to a boil over medium high heat, stirring constantly. Immediately remove from heat. Stir in peanut butter, butter and vanilla until butter is melted. Mix thoroughly. Transfer to a serving bowl. Press plastic wrap over pudding surface to prevent skin from forming. Serve warm or cold. This recipe serves 8.
